Lot Description
A modern pair of silver two branch candelabra, each with central tapering and fluted column leading to an oval filled base with conforming fluted decoration, the detachable upper section with fluted urn shape socket having a detachable oval nozzle, and with two looped branches leading to conforming sockets and nozzles on either side, the central section also with a detachable snuffer with flame finial, the whole with reeded border detail throughout. Hallmarked Mappin & Webb Ltd., Sheffield 1968. Maximum height including central snuffer measures 13 inches (33cm).

Condition Report
Both candlesticks display general wear, surface marks and scratches and also a little tarnishing. There are various minor nicks in the metal all over and also some small dints in places, especially to edges and borders. On one of the candelabrum, there appears to have been a repair to one side of the oval base and also possibly around the base of the tapering column. On this same candelabrum the upper section appears jammed and cannot be removed and there is also damage to the drip pans on either side, one in particular has large splits in the metal. The other candelabrum appears to be in slightly better condition, although one of the detachable nozzles is jammed and cannot be removed. Hallmarks and part hallmarks are clear and legible.
